Question 1: What is 'flex fuel tuning' in chiptuning?
- Tuning for flexible dyno schedules
- Calibrating the ECU to automatically adjust fueling and timing based on ethanol content in the fuel (Correct answer)
- Using two separate ECUs for redundancy
- Tuning for both automatic and manual transmission modes
Correct answer: Calibrating the ECU to automatically adjust fueling and timing based on ethanol content in the fuel
Flex fuel tuning uses an ethanol content sensor to let the ECU blend between gasoline and E85 maps in real time, optimizing power and safety for any ethanol mixture.
Question 2: Which of the following is a common symptom of over-advanced ignition timing?
- Black smoke from exhaust
- Engine knock or ping, especially under load (Correct answer)
- Rough idle from excessive fuel
- Turbo compressor surge
Correct answer: Engine knock or ping, especially under load
Over-advanced timing causes the air-fuel mixture to ignite too early, leading to detonation (knock/ping) that can rapidly damage pistons and bearings.
Question 3: What does 'closed-loop fueling' mean in ECU operation?
- The fuel system runs at fixed injector duty cycle
- The ECU uses O2 sensor feedback to continuously correct the fuel mixture toward a target AFR (Correct answer)
- Fuel pressure is regulated mechanically without ECU input
- The injectors fire in a fixed sequence regardless of load
Correct answer: The ECU uses O2 sensor feedback to continuously correct the fuel mixture toward a target AFR
Closed-loop operation means the ECU reads oxygen sensor feedback and trims fueling in real time to maintain the target air-fuel ratio.

Question 5: What is 'blow-off valve' (BOV) function in a turbocharged chiptuned car?
- Release excess fuel pressure
- Vent compressed charge air when the throttle closes to prevent turbo compressor surge (Correct answer)
- Control boost pressure at maximum RPM
- Regulate oil pressure to the turbo bearing
Correct answer: Vent compressed charge air when the throttle closes to prevent turbo compressor surge
When the throttle snaps shut, a BOV vents pressurized intake air to atmosphere (or recirculates it), preventing the pressure wave from stalling the turbo compressor.
Question 6: Which parameter does a tuner adjust to change how quickly boost builds in a turbocharged engine?
- Wastegate duty cycle solenoid map (Correct answer)
- Injector dead time table
- Idle air control valve position
- Throttle body bore size
Correct answer: Wastegate duty cycle solenoid map
The wastegate duty cycle solenoid controls how much boost pressure acts on the wastegate actuator, directly influencing boost onset rate and peak target.
Question 7: What does 'decel fuel cut' (DFCO) mean in an ECU map?
- Cutting fuel when coolant temperature drops
- Stopping fuel injection during deceleration with a closed throttle to save fuel (Correct answer)
- Reducing fuel pressure during hard braking
- Cutting injector pulse width at redline
Correct answer: Stopping fuel injection during deceleration with a closed throttle to save fuel
DFCO disables fuel injection when the driver lifts off above a minimum RPM threshold, improving fuel economy and reducing emissions during coast-down.
